With a heavy heart: Fort Eustis Soldier wins Military Citizen of the Year
September 24, 2020
U.S. Army Sgt. 1st Class Corrie Ferrin, 1-210th Aviation Regiment senior instructor, stares out the window of his work center on Sept. 18, 2020 at Joint-Base Langley Eustis, Virginia. Ferrin was awarded Military Citizen of the Year by the Virginia Peninsula Chamber of Commerce. Ferrin was nominated for his volunteer efforts in taking care of Soldiers and their families during the COVID-19 pandemic. (U.S. Air Force photo by Staff Sgt. Joshua Magbanua)
